Consequences even for believers

February 22, 2016 By Austin Gardner Leave a Comment

I Kings 9:9 And they shall answer, Because they forsook the LORD their God, who brought forth their fathers out of the land of Egypt, and have taken hold upon other gods, and have worshipped them, and served them: therefore hath the LORD brought upon them all this evil.

Grace is never an excuse to sin but rather a call to serve. God had made great promises to Solomon about Israel. He told Solomon that if he would honor God with his life that God would do great things with the country. However if the nation Israel decided to worship other gods and not obey God then they would lose all His blessings.

Israel does end up losing all of God’s blessings. They will be kicked out of their country. The nation will be mocked. All because they decide to take God for granted. They decide that they can have God and other gods as well. They suffer the consequences.

I think sometimes there is a tendency because we understand that God loves us, that we are saved by His grace, to take Him for granted. We think that because He loves us we can just about ignore Him. Our behavior doesn’t affect our salvation, nor does it affect His love for us but sin does have consequences.

If I don’t honor Him then He will not honor me. If I lightly esteem Him then He will lightly esteem my desires and comforts. Sin hurts. If you do not honor God you must know that your disobedience will affect your family. It will affect you. He is good but that doesn’t mean that you can ignore Him or take Him lightly.
